Schengen Visa: Understanding Dummy Tickets & Alternatives
Securing a Schengen permit can sometimes demand a showing of travel itineraries , which has previously led many applicants to consider using provisional copyright . However, obtaining such passes can be problematic and potentially lead to refusal of your application . Thankfully, there are valid options available, such as providing a booked but refundable flight itinerary that showcases your intended arrival and departure dates. Always check the particular guidelines provided by the embassy for the latest information.

copyright Papers for Visa? Preventing Deceptions and Refusal
Securing a permit can be a intricate process, and sadly, dishonest individuals exploit this by offering bogus tickets. These fraudulent schemes often promise a quick and easy route to entry, but attempting to use these paperwork will almost certainly lead to refusal of your petition and potentially serious legal ramifications. Be exceptionally cautious of anyone claiming to provide guaranteed entry approval through a third-party provider, especially if they demand a large upfront payment. Here's what to watch out for:
- Astonishingly low prices generally indicate a scam.
- Solicitations for sensitive information via unsecured channels, like messaging.
- Urgency to make a immediate decision without proper research.
- Promises of visa approval, which no genuine source can offer.
Always confirm information directly with the official consulate website or contact their directly to avoid possible issues.
